Brockley Carpet Bowls Club
The club is now partaking in the Suffolk Summer League which is a bit more easy going than the
Winter Leagues competitions. It is an opportunity for new and less experienced bowlers to try their
hand at competitive bowls. Our first match should have been against Lawshall but, unfortunately due
to lack of numbers, they had to withdraw from the Summer League. However Brockley invited them
to play a friendly which they duly did; out captain reports as follows:
We had a great start to the season with a warm up against Lawshall, We ran out 10-0 winners with a
63-17 shot advantage. The score makes it look like they were bad, but they played really well.
On Mat 1 Keith, Steve, Pete W & Pete J had a close game and were 6-2 down after 5 ends, but a 4 on
the next end left it level and ended with a 10-7 win.
On Mat 2 Bob, Karen, Irving & Sue were 3-2 down after 4 ends, but never lost another end and after
some great bowling and a 7 on end 9 ended up 19-3 winners.
In the second half on Mat 1Jean & Richard started well with some great bowling and never lost an
end until the 7th & ended up with a 16-3 win.
Whilst on Mat 2 Jackie & Andrew E shot off to a great start, especially with a 6 on end 3, more top
bowling put them up for an 18-4 win.
Next up was our first league game proper at home to Cockfield and it was back to earth with a bump.
Not the start we would have wanted for the season's first game. It ended with a 4-6 loss 38-40 shots,
going into the last 4 ends we were 8 shots up, but it wasn't to be. Hopefully we can do better against
Hundon this week. We just need the 4s to match the pairs.
On Mat 1 Keith, Gillian, Pete W and Pete J, had a bad start losing the first 5 ends to Steve's team.
But were much improved for the next 5, dropping 1 shot and ended with a 6-12 loss.
Mat 2 saw Bob, Karen, Irving and Sue have a slightly better game but struggled to make an impact
against Sarah's team. A 5-9 loss.
Second half on Mat 1 Jean and Richard started very well and were 15-2 up after 7 ends but
unfortunately dropped 9 shots on the last 3 ends. A good 15-11 win against Colin's team.
On Mat 2 Jackie and Andrew had a poor start against Jeremy's team dropping 4 shots in the first 2
ends, but a great 4 on end 3 made it level and they never looked back. Another good win 12-8.
A Bounce Back! We got our first win of the season against Hundon 8 - 2 and 48 - 24 shots. Well
played all! A resounding win which at the time of writing has put us in second place in the league.
On mat 1 Gillian, Bill, Pete W and Pete J started well against Kevin's 4 and were 4 up after 2 ends,
but dropped 4 on the next to even things up. Then went on to only drop 1 more, finished with a
13 - 5 win.
On mat 2 Sue, Karen, Bob and Andy were playing Ian's 4 and had a brilliant 5 on end 3. They carried
on adding shots including a 4 on end 6 to end up with a 14 - 5 win, only losing 3 ends route to
victory.
The pair of Jean and Richard had a great game with Ralph's 2 on mat 1. It included 2 fives to give
them the best result of the night, a 16 - 5 win.
Jackie and Andrew came up against the formidable Ellen who was on top form on mat 2 and
unfortunately had a 5 - 9 loss despite winning the last four ends.
